Description

This resource provides students with authentic Cambridge-style practice using a variety of graph formats commonly found on the exam. Students move beyond simply reading values by calculating differences, percentage changes, annual totals, temperature ranges, and interpreting trends using numerical evidence.

Designed for classroom instruction, independent practice, homework, review sessions, or exam preparation, these worksheets help students strengthen essential quantitative and analytical skills while becoming familiar with Cambridge command words.
